About This Scholarship

The purpose of the Kappa Kappa Iota Scholarship is to assist high school seniors in Elk City Public Schools or Canute Public Schools. Applicants must plan to major in education. A transcript, resume and cover letter are required.

When applying for scholarships, you should NEVER have to pay to apply. You should also NEVER have to provide sensitive personal information like your Social Security Number (SSN). If membership is required to apply, the membership should ALWAYS BE FREE. Basically, NEVER PAY FOR ANYTHING. Those are scams! Some scholarships may ask for your address or proof of enrollment. That's fine, but always verify you're actually talking to the scholarship provider and not an imposter. Scams in scholarships are rampant, be careful!
